Our Products 

Latest Solar Panels – 2020 

Our PV manufacture in Germany does not produce 72 cell panels anymore. Very sensitive in harsh weather conditions. Abandoned producing Poly panels since 2014. Even the scraps from Mono are used to make Poly.

More power. More yield & Standard 25 years’ Product guarantee.

Similar to aleo X59L 315W modules that we did, the newly introduced modules are distinguished by first-class German workmanship with high-quality components. Mono-PERC larger cells design expected to achieve 3 to 4 % higher output than to our predecessor modules.

X59L 315W

P23L 325W

X63L 330W


We introduce you the following options of world best class Solar inverters to align you budget.

10 Years Warranty

10 Years Warranty

10 Years Warranty

Mounting Systems 

DC/AC Cables

Other Accessories